Why are Chelsea stockpiling so many young players – and can they afford it?

The accounting model makes sense because long-term contracts and amortization – the cost of spreading transfers over the long term – allows Chelsea to enable players like Caicedo to be at a relatively “lower” weekly, but he joined the UK transfer record of £115 million from Brighton in 2023.

Ukrainian winger Mykhailo Mudryk (Ukrainian winger Mykhailo Mudryk) joins Chelsea as Shakhtar Donetsk in 2023, up to £89 million (including add-ons), enjoying $97,000 per week on a 2031 contract.

But these longer contracts may be problematic.

Mudryk is currently suspended After testing for a positive ban. If convicted, he could face a four-year ban, while still having years of Chelsea deals.

Then, what if the player wants to go out? In the overlapping podcast, Jamie Carragher asked if there was a club that could afford Chelsea star Mann Cole Palmer.

Last year, organizers Contract renewal until 2033But Carragher said he could see the 22-year-old “frustration” with some teammates who were underperforming.

“It reminds me of Liverpool’s Steve (Gerard) because he’s a lot better than everyone else, and he’s frustrated. Steve is a local player, but he’s never leaving, and Cole Palmer doesn’t.

“This is when I go back to those eight years of contracts and whether they are good for the club and the players.

“If you’re Palmer, he has six to seven years left in the deal, and he should play for a team that wants to win the Champions League, how can he get out?”

This is an unknown territory, and despite its meaning on the balance sheet, is the human side ignored?

There are also some young players like Cesare Casadei, Renato Veiga and Carney Chukwuemeka who all left Chelsea in January, and multiple young stars are fighting for the same roles due to the lack of all kinds of frustrations of minutes.

Forward Christopher Nkunku was offered by other clubs and other players in January (such as midfielder Kiernan Dewsbury -Hall), who joined only last summer – faced uncertainty before the next transfer window.
